One of summer’s tastiest gifts is a basket of juicy ripe tomatoes fresh from the vine. With a day’s work and a little know-how, you can enjoy your bounty of summer tomatoes year-round.

Not only do home-grown tomatoes taste delicious (BLT, anyone?), they’re packed with vitamin C, vitamin A and powerful antioxidants known for fighting cancer and disease.

Preserve them in a number of ways:

• Peel and freeze (whole or chopped) for use in sandwiches, salads and cooked dishes.

• Can tomatoes using a boiling water canner or pressure canner.

• Dry tomatoes using your oven or a dehydrator and store them in the freezer in an airtight container.
